Lebanese Report Says Three Drone Strikes Hit a Village in Southern Lebanon
The Hezbollah-aligned Lebanese newspaper Al-Akhbar reported three drone strikes in the village of Mifdoun in southern Lebanon.
The report did not identify who carried out the strikes, when exactly they occurred, or whether there were any casualties or damage. No additional details were provided in the brief item.
The location, Mifdoun, is in southern Lebanon, an area that has seen repeated tension and military activity in the wider Israel-Lebanon conflict. The report was limited to the claim of three separate UAV attacks.
